for 2 servings of healthy chocolate pudding:

1/4 cup shelled sunflower seeds

3 Tablespoons unsweetened, dark cocoa powder

1 ripe avocado, peeled and pitted

1 and 1/2 large bananas, peeled and frozen and cut into chunks

2 Tablespoons raw honey

1/4 teaspoon cinnamon

1/8 teaspoon nutmeg

pinch of sea salt

2 Tablespoons sweetened or unsweetened vanilla almond milk

Place sunflower seeds in a small bowl and cover them with water. Soak seeds for 1 hour. Drain seeds and place them, along with all of the other ingredients, in the bowl of a food processor. Pulse until completely smooth.

Scoop into 2 wide-mouth jelly jars or dessert cups. Top with honey-sweetened whipped cream and a few Paleo chocolate chips.
